Arturo Ruiz Ruiz, a cherished husband, father, brother, and grandfather, passed away peacefully on December 31, 2025, at the age of 53, after a courageous two-year battle with cancer. Born on March 18, 1972, in San Luis de la Paz, Guanajuato, Mexico, Arturo later made his home in Dallas, Texas, where he built a life filled with hard work, family, and love.
Arturo was a devoted husband to his beloved wife Miriam, a nurturing father to his son Arturo and daughters Adriana and Yesica, and a proud grandfather to his grandchildren Abigail, Madelyn, Olivia, and Adriel. His loving presence was a constant source of strength and joy for them.
A man of simple pleasures, Arturo was rarely seen without his favorite vaquero attire and sombrero, which became his signature look. These reflected his deep connection to his roots, rich culture, and enduring pride in his heritage.
Arturo’s memory will forever be cherished by his family, friends, and all who knew him. The legacy of his compassion, kindness, and the wisdom he shared will continue to inspire those he leaves behind.
His final resting place will be Laurel Oaks Memorial Park in Balch Springs, Texas.
